Transaction 505f3556aab70cd27934e90263d52d3199ebfb31f77a90ab138ad5c9dc7c66be
4 Input
2 Outputs
- 505f3556aab70cd27934e90263d52d3199ebfb31f77a90ab138ad5c9dc7c66be:0
- 505f3556aab70cd27934e90263d52d3199ebfb31f77a90ab138ad5c9dc7c66be:1
value 96000000
address 3976tZdk1QX3QGnDFCfYayif3j5Gi96gwg
value 11107247
address 3HbEvYZyKUCbAF9P8t3jEU1n6bgK7nG8Hv